Made by the Swedish Parans, Skyport is a light collecting panel that sits on your rooftop to transmit light into your home. It uses a fibre-optic wire, called SunWire, to send the light to specially designed 'lamps', in this instance a model called Bjork that replicates "the sun striking through the foliage of a forest" (Bjork is the Swedish word for birch tree). The light can be transported up to 15 meters. With a 7 meter cable, the light intensity can reach 4000 lux. Two SkyPorts mounted on an angle makes it possible to bring in both the morning- and afternoon sun. Thanks David! Via near near future.
